- HLAVNA STANICA Close to the main train station and 15 minutes walk from historical center. There are ministerial buildings in the area, as well as the presidential palace. The banks of the river Danube are not far away and you can reach them by a short walk. Near there is also the park Námestie Slobody. In the neigbourhood you''ll easily find restaurants and bars. Easy accces to public transport.
- ZAHORSKA BYSTRICA. Zahorska Bystrica district is a unique place which combines a peaceful and nice quiet location and at the same time is located only around 8 minutes drive from the city-centre of Bratislava.
Many of the rich people of Bratislava as well as diplomats choose to live in this district as it offers the benefits of city life combined with a nice and quiet location. In contrast to the modern neighbourhoods of today with its new buildings, Záhorská Bystrica has preserved its country-like character with its typical houses and huge gardens.
- MLYNSKE NIVY Situated north from the river and very close to the Old Town. By a pleasant walk you may easily reach all the most important monuments, museums and art galleries. Nearby there is the Danube and one of the main old town streets, the Dunajska: here you may have a look at the statue of Julo Satinsky, known as the Boy from Dunajská” a renowned Slovak actor, who spent most of his life living on this street. Very close there are shops, bars and restaurants, as well as the TESCO supermarket. The neighbourhood is well connected to the rest of the city by buses and trams. At Mlynske Nivy there is also the Main Bus Station
- CENTRE.This is the most interesting area from a monumental point of view and most of the historical buildings are situated here. The City council of Bratislava is nowadays the Museum of the City of Bratislava. The cathedrals and remarkable churches include the Gothic cathedral of Saint Martín, where the kings of Hungary were crowned between 1563 and 1830. The Franciscan church is the oldest sacred building of the city. This district is dynamic and welcoming, and you can take advantage of a big variety of shops and services, although the prices are noticeably higher compared to other parts of the city. The public transportation consist of three main types of vehicles : autobúses, trams and trolley buses.
